Fig. 3. siRNA-LNP provide stringent gene knockdown in cell lines and AML blast.

Fig. 3

af Kasumi-1 cells were treated with 2 µg/ml siRNA-LNPs for 24 h then washed thrice in PBS. The knockdown of RUNX1/ETO relative to GAPDH on day 3 at the transcript level (a) (n = 5) and in western blotting (b). c Proliferation curve of Kasumi-1 cells following siRNA-LNPs treatment (n = 3). d Cell cycle profile of Kasumi-1 cells on day 6. e Quantification of senescent cells on day 6 by beta galactosidase staining (n = 3). f Colony formation units of Kasumi-1 cells in first and second platings (n = 3). g Schematic illustration of AML blast co-culture on MSCs feeders and treatment with siRNA-LNPs. h RUNX1/ETO expression relative to GAPDH in different t(8;21) AML blasts following siRNA-LNPs treatment. i Western blotting showing RUNX1/ETO, RUNX1, CCND2 and GAPDH in two AML samples after siRNA-LNPs treatment. Significance was tested by unpaired Student’s t tests (a, c, e, f).
